JOB GOAL:

AVID stands for Advancement Via Individual Determination and is a program designed to provide the academic, social, and emotional support that targets potential college students who need academic assistance. AVID prepares these students by teaching them college and career readiness skills. Students are enrolled in advanced courses and given academic support through tutorial opportunities.
